The museum Banfetal in Banfe is a museum of local history and traditions. It is run by the Wander- und Heimatfreunde Banfetal.
Foundation and building
The museum was founded in 1965. It is housed in a half-timbered house from 1793.
Exhibitions
The following collection focuses are presented on approximately 800 m² of exhibition space:
- Prehistory and early history
- Rural living and working world
- Housekeeping and self-sufficiency
- Crafts (village blacksmiths, cartwright, cooperage, shoemaking, tailoring, carpenter)
- Industry, steelworks, mining with mineral collection and exhibition tunnels
- Children's world and school class, forestry and nature, technology.
An East German Heimatstube is also on display. This exhibition was founded in 1985 and was compiled with material from displaced persons from Silesia, Pomerania and Prussia.
Concept and special features
The concept envisages “making the story tangible”. In November 2014, for example, previously unseen shots of the opening of the Rothaargebirge Nature Park with Federal President Heinrich Lübke in 1964 were shown.
